Ganesh’s Orange to be released on December 7

The film will clash at the box office with Shivarajkumar's Kavacha

CE Features

Seems like Ganesh-starrer Orange is set to clash at the box office with Shivarajkumar's Kavacha. The film directed by Prashant Raj has cleared the censors with a U/A certificate and is all set to hit the screens on December 7.  With the release date fixed, the makers will soon finalise the distribution and theatres.

The actor-director duo of Ganesh and Prashant Raj have collaborated on this film for the second time after Zoom. The romantic entertainer, produced by Naveen under Nimma Cinema banner, has Bollywood heroine, Priya Anand, as the female lead. Dev Gill, who is making a comeback to Kannada cinema, is playing the antagonist.

Orange has an ensemble cast that includes Sadhu Kokila, Rangayana Raghu, Avinash, Harish Raj, Padmaja Rao, and Sathya Bhama.  The film has music by S Thaman and cinematography by Santhosh Rai Pathaje.
